- Friendster gets new CEO, $20 million in funding and a focus on Asia
- Friendster was one of the early social networks, but wound up being surpassed by MySpace and Facebook in the U.S. The fix: Keep its lead in Asia, land $20 million in new funding and hire a new CEO. On Tuesday, Friendster said it named Richard Kimber as...

- Nielsen/NetRatings on online dating profits
- Nielsen//NetRatings finds that since it has been monitoring traffic on Friendster in June 2003, its unique audience has risen by 74%. Nielsen also found that in October, Friendster visitors were spending an average one hour and 51 minutes on the site. Nielsen compares this average time to the average time...
